HOUSE BILL 1202

AN ACT relative to renewable energy credits.

SPONSORS: Rep. S. Harvey, Hills 21

COMMITTEE: Science, Technology and Energy

ANALYSIS

This bill adds a category to electric renewable energy Class I.

STATE OF NEW HAMPSHIRE

In the Year of Our Lord Two Thousand Ten

AN ACT relative to renewable energy credits.

Be it En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Court convened:

1 New Subparagraph; Electric Renewable Energy Classes. Amend RSA 362-F:4, I by inserting after subparagraph (j) the following new subparagraph:

(k) The use of technology, by water utilities, that captures the energy in water pressure and converts it to electricity.

2 Effective Date. This act shall take effect 60 days after its passage.
